beabadoobee Releases New Track 'Coming Home'
by Josh Sharpe - Jun 5, 2024


Critically-acclaimed indie icon beabadoobee has released “Coming Home” from her upcoming third studio album This Is How Tomorrow Moves out August 16 via Dirty Hit. Channeling her love for The Beatles, “Coming Home” is a sweet, nostalgic track about missing loved ones while on the road, complemented with warm, starry-eyed lyricism and a flourish of muted trumpet. Josh O'Connor, Andrew Scott, & Cailee Spaeny Join KNIVES OUT 3
by Josh Sharpe - May 28, 2024


Following last week's announcement that Knives Out 3 will officially be titled Wake Up Dead Man, subsequent reports have revealed that Josh O'Connor, Cailee Spaeny, and Andrew Scott have all joined the whodunnit. They star alongside Daniel Craig, who will be reprising his role as fan-favorite detective Benoit Blanc.
